The AOD4N60 belongs to the category of power MOSFETs.
It is commonly used in electronic circuits and power supply applications.
The AOD4N60 is typically available in a TO-252 package.
This MOSFET is essential for controlling high-power loads in various electronic devices and systems.
It is usually packaged in reels or tubes, with quantities varying based on manufacturer specifications.
The AOD4N60 typically has three pins: 1. Gate (G) 2. Drain (D) 3. Source (S)
The AOD4N60 operates based on the principles of field-effect transistors, where the voltage applied to the gate terminal controls the flow of current between the drain and source terminals.
The AOD4N60 is widely used in the following applications: - Switching power supplies - Motor control - LED lighting - Audio amplifiers - DC-DC converters
